usb_power_delivery_register_capabilities() returns ERR_PTR in case of
failure. usb_power_delivery_unregister_capabilities() we only check
argument ("cap") for NULL. A more robust check would be checking for
ERR_PTR as well.

Existing last step of dsc policy is to restore pbn value under minimum compression
when try to greedily disable dsc for a stream failed to fit in MST bw.
Optimized dsc params result from optimization step is not necessarily the minimum compression,
therefore it is not correct to restore the pbn under minimum compression rate.
Restore the pbn under minimum compression instead of the value from optimized pbn could result
in the dsc params not correct at the modeset where atomic_check failed due to not
enough bw. One or more monitors connected could not light up in such case.
Restore the optimized pbn value, instead of using the pbn value under minimum
compression.
